汽车电脑板编程需要什么
-
汽车电脑板编程需要以下几个方面的内容:
-
硬件知识:汽车电脑板编程需要对汽车电脑板的硬件结构和工作原理有一定的了解。这包括对汽车电路、传感器、执行器等组件的功能和连接方式有一定的认识。
-
编程语言:汽车电脑板编程通常使用的是嵌入式系统的编程语言,如C、C++等。熟练掌握这些编程语言,能够编写高效、稳定的代码。
-
数据通信协议:汽车电脑板编程需要使用一些数据通信协议与其他系统进行数据交互,如CAN、LIN、FlexRay等。了解这些通信协议的工作原理和使用方式,能够实现与其他系统的数据交换。
-
故障诊断和调试:汽车电脑板编程需要具备故障诊断和调试的能力。当汽车出现问题时,能够通过读取电脑板的故障码和数据,分析问题的原因并进行修复。
-
算法和逻辑思维:汽车电脑板编程需要应用一些算法和逻辑思维来实现各种功能。例如,通过传感器数据进行车辆稳定性控制、排放控制、节能措施等。
-
汽车行业知识:了解汽车行业的相关知识,包括汽车电子系统的发展趋势、汽车标准和法规等,能够更好地进行汽车电脑板编程。
总之,汽车电脑板编程需要对汽车电脑板硬件、编程语言、数据通信协议、故障诊断、算法和逻辑思维以及汽车行业知识有一定的了解和掌握。只有综合运用这些知识和技能,才能编写出高效、稳定的汽车电脑板程序。
1年前 -
-
汽车电脑板编程是指对汽车的电脑控制单元(ECU)进行编程,以调整引擎性能、燃油经济性、排放控制等参数。下面是进行汽车电脑板编程所需要的要素:
-
专业的编程工具:进行汽车电脑板编程需要一套专业的编程工具,如汽车诊断仪、编程仪器等。这些工具可以连接到车辆的OBD(On-Board Diagnostic)接口,与车辆的ECU进行通信,并进行编程操作。
-
编程软件:进行汽车电脑板编程需要使用相应的编程软件。这些软件通常由汽车制造商或第三方开发,并根据不同的车型和ECU类型提供不同的程序。
-
车辆信息和技术知识:进行汽车电脑板编程需要对车辆的相关信息有一定了解,包括车辆的年份、品牌、型号、发动机类型等。此外,还需要掌握相关的技术知识,了解ECU的工作原理、编程参数的含义等。
-
专业的编程技能:进行汽车电脑板编程需要具备一定的编程技能。这包括了解编程语言和算法、理解二进制编码、掌握调试和测试技巧等。同时,还需要对汽车电子系统有一定的了解,以便能够正确地进行编程操作。
-
车辆备份和风险评估:在进行汽车电脑板编程之前,需要对车辆进行备份,以防止编程操作出现问题导致车辆无法正常运行。此外,还需要进行风险评估,评估编程操作可能带来的潜在风险,并采取相应的措施进行风险控制。
综上所述,进行汽车电脑板编程需要专业的编程工具、编程软件,以及车辆信息、技术知识、编程技能和风险评估能力。这些要素的综合运用可以帮助进行有效和安全的汽车电脑板编程。
1年前 -
-
汽车电脑板编程是指对汽车电子控制单元(ECU)进行编程,以实现对汽车各种功能的控制和优化。在进行汽车电脑板编程之前,需要准备以下几个方面的工具和知识。
-
OBD-II扫描工具:OBD-II(On-Board Diagnostics)是汽车诊断系统的标准接口,用于与汽车电脑板进行通信。选择一个兼容的OBD-II扫描工具是进行汽车电脑板编程的基础。
-
编程软件:根据汽车的品牌和型号,选择相应的编程软件。不同品牌和型号的车辆可能使用不同的编程软件,例如VAG-COM、FORScan等。这些软件通常提供了对汽车电脑板的诊断、编程和配置功能。
-
电脑:需要一台配备有Windows操作系统的电脑,并安装相应的编程软件。
-
软件驱动程序:有些编程软件需要安装特定的驱动程序,以便与汽车电脑板进行通信。在安装编程软件之前,需要确保电脑上已经安装了所需的驱动程序。
-
编程接口设备:某些汽车电脑板编程需要使用编程接口设备,例如EEPROM编程器、J2534编程接口等。这些设备可用于读取、写入和修改汽车电脑板上的EEPROM数据。
-
车辆数据备份:在进行汽车电脑板编程之前,建议先备份车辆的原始数据。这样,如果出现问题,可以恢复到原始状态。
在准备好上述工具和知识之后,可以按照以下步骤进行汽车电脑板编程:
-
连接OBD-II扫描工具:将OBD-II扫描工具插入车辆的OBD-II接口,通常位于驾驶室下方的驾驶员侧。确保扫描工具与车辆的电脑板成功连接。
-
启动编程软件:打开所选的编程软件,并根据软件的指引进行操作。通常,软件会自动识别与OBD-II接口连接的车辆。
-
选择编程功能:根据需要,选择相应的编程功能,例如诊断、编程、配置等。不同的编程软件提供了不同的功能选项。
-
进行编程操作:根据软件的指引,进行具体的编程操作。这可能包括读取和修改电脑板上的EEPROM数据、修改参数配置等。
-
测试和验证:在完成编程操作后,进行测试和验证,确保编程的效果符合预期。可以通过重新启动车辆并观察各项功能是否正常工作来进行验证。
需要注意的是,汽车电脑板编程涉及到对车辆的重要控制系统进行操作,因此需要具备一定的专业知识和技能。如果不熟悉或不确定如何进行编程操作,建议寻求专业人士的帮助,以避免可能的风险和损失。
1年前 -